
Sarnafil® G 410-80 SA EnergySmart
Sarnafil® G 410-80 SA EnergySmart Roof Membrane is a PVC thermoplastic membrane with a factory applied pressure‐sensitive adhesive backing and siliconized polyethylene release liner. It is produced with an integral fiberglass mat reinforcement for excellent dimensional stability, is highly reflective, with heat‐weldable seams, and a unique lacquer coating applied to the top of the membrane to reduce dirt pick up.

Composition / Manufacturing
High‐quality PVC membrane containing ultraviolet light stabilizers, flame retardant, fiberglass reinforcement, with a unique lacquer coating on the top surface and pressure‐sensitive adhesive with a removable siliconized polyethylene release liner on the back surface.
Reinforcing Material
Fibreglass
Shelf Life
Sarnafil® G 410-80 SA EnergySmart has a shelf life of up to 12 months. An extension may be offered, when properly stored between 60 °F (16 °C) and 80 °F (27 °C), and out of direct sunlight upon technical review.
Storage Conditions
Store rolls on pallets and fully protected from the weather with clean canvas tarpaulins. Unvented polyethylene tarpaulins are not accepted due to the accumulation of moisture beneath the tarpaulin in certain weather conditions that may affect the ease of membrane weldability.

Application
APPLICATION
Sarnafil® G 410-80 SA EnergySmart is installed after proper preparation of the approved substrate. The membrane is unrolled and positioned in place with the selvage edge lapping the adjacent roll to allow for the 76 mm (3") side lap. Fold back half of the sheet onto itself in the long direction and carefully cut the release liner with the cutting tool provided by Sika without damaging the membrane. Peel back 76 mm- 127 mm (3 "- 5") of the release liner and press firmly onto the substrate. Weight may be necessary on the membrane when first starting. Continue removing the release liner from the membrane in a smooth, wrinkle‐free manner while maintaining the 76 mm (3") side lap. Immediately roll the membrane with a minimum 45 kg (100 lb) steel roller. Remove the remaining release liner from the other half of the membrane using the above process and immediately roll the membrane with the steel roller. Sarnafil® G 410-80 SA EnergySmart side lap seams are heat‐welded together by trained operators using hot‐air welding equipment. End laps and all cut edges are butted together and an 203 mm (8") Sarnafil® G 410 coverstrip is hot‐air welded over the butt and cut edge joints.
